An artist brings his painting of 'the perfect woman' to life.
A young man seeking adventure sets off to sail around the world. But during a violent storm, he is taken prisoner by a ship full of pirates.
An alien realtor tries to sell the earth to a prospective client as a "summer vacation planet."
A method actor who scares people in his movies is a hen-pecked husband in real life.
An evil man is haunted by a demon that rides on his back.
While the indicia title is still "Red Circle Sorcery", the cover title is just "Sorcery" now. On-sale date from Comic Reader (Street Enterprises, 1973 series) #110, September 1974.
- Horror Films - Portraits of Lon Chaney Sr., Bela Lugosi, Boris Karloff, and Lon Chaney Jr.
- The Final Battle - text story includes an ad for Red Circle's mystery line.
